Re: Worst Propaganda movie?
Karl Ritter's anti Communist film 'GPU'. Really badly acted and in many ways a precursor to the Hollywood shock/horror anti Communist films of the 1950s. GPU was made in 1942 so Ritter could give full reign to his anti Communist views.
Another Ritter film which I've just purchased on DVD is 'Kadetten', a 1939 production that wasn't released at the time due to the Nazi/Soviet pact (it was finally released in December 1941). It's based around events during the Seven Year's War and is actually quite good. Aimed at the Hitler Youth market, it tells of a group of cadets from the Potsdam Military Academy who are taken hostage when Cossacks seize Berlin.
Ritter's films are still banned in Germany though I think that GPU should be banned because it is so bad!
